이더리움 핵심 개발자들이 롤업을 중심으로 이더리움의 로드맵을 제시했기 때문에 롤업이 이더리움의 미래에서 중심적인 역할을 할 것이 분명합니다. 그러나 오랫동안 약속된 데이터 샤딩(또는 Danksharding)이 실현되기 전에 이더리움은 가능한 한 빨리 거래 수수료를 줄여야 합니다. 그렇지 않으면 새로운 사용자를 다른 L1으로 계속 잃을 위험이 있습니다.
선도적인 Rollup 팀은 거래 수수료를 줄이고 해당 L2에서 개발자 경험을 향상시키기 위한 자체 솔루션을 제시했습니다. 여기에는 트랜잭션 압축 기술을 최적화하는 Optimism 팀과 Arbitrum 팀이 포함됩니다. Arbitrum은 Arbitrum Fraud Proof를 WASM으로 컴파일하여 Arbitrum L2의 개발자 경험을 크게 향상시키고 대기 시간을 줄이는 차세대 업그레이드인 Arbitrum Nitro를 출시했습니다.
그러나 L2 트랜잭션의 단위 비용을 살펴보면 가장 큰 청크가 "Call Data"임을 알 수 있습니다. 통화 데이터는 L2의 보안 메커니즘에 매우 중요합니다. 기본적으로 L2에서 악의적인 검증인 활동이 발생하는 경우 L1에서 발행된 Call Data를 사용하여 전체 L2 체인을 재구성할 수 있습니다. 그러나 L1에 통화 데이터를 게시하는 것은 비용이 많이 들고 현재 L2 거래 수수료의 80% 이상을 차지합니다.
그렇다면 이 문제를 어떻게 해결해야 할까요? 근본적으로 L2 트랜잭션 수수료를 줄이기 위해서는 L1의 데이터를 위한 더 많은 공간이 생성되어야 합니다. 데이터 샤딩(DankSharding)은 이더리움 L1에 거대한 데이터 공간을 구축하는 데 도움이 되지만 이더리움에서 DankSharding을 완전히 구현하려면 꽤 오랜 시간(모든 것이 순조롭게 진행된다면 약 18개월)이 걸릴 것으로 예상됩니다.
이것이 이더리움 코어 개발자와 롤업 팀이 L1에 즉각적인 데이터 공간을 구축하고 롤업이 L1 시장에서 즉시 가격 경쟁력을 갖추도록 다르게 제안하기 시작한 이유입니다. EIP-4844는 이러한 노력의 결과이며 롤업 수수료를 대폭 낮출 것으로 예상됩니다.
이전 기사에서 우리는 이더리움의 새로운 샤딩 디자인인 DankSharding에 대해 살펴보았습니다. 이 디자인은 이전 디자인에 비해 상당히 단순화되었습니다. proto-danksharding이라고도 알려진 EIP-4844는 기본적으로 데이터 샤딩 사양의 대부분의 로직을 구현하고 Danksharding을 준비합니다.
그래서 이것은 어떻게 이루어 집니까?
Danksharding은 L1 블록의 트랜잭션에 더 많은 공간을 제공하는 대신 데이터 자체(트랜잭션 데이터의 덩어리)에 더 많은 공간을 제공합니다. 이 데이터 Blob은 네트워크에서 액세스할 수 있어야 합니다. 롤업은 이러한 데이터 blob의 공간을 활용하고 여기에 압축된 트랜잭션 데이터를 저장합니다. blob을 전달하는 트랜잭션은 blob이라는 추가 데이터 블록이 있는 일반 트랜잭션입니다. 더 비싼 호출 데이터에 비해 Blob은 데이터 크기가 크고 L2에 더 많은 데이터 공간을 제공할 수 있습니다.
EIP-4844의 장점은 무엇입니까?
출처: Pseudotheos 주장 (https://twitter.com/pseudotheos/status/1504457560396468231/photo/1)
EIP-4844의 또 다른 장점은 Danksharding의 향후 응용 프로그램을 위한 좋은 토양을 제공하여 향후 데이터 샤딩을 쉽게 구현할 수 있다는 것입니다. 구체적인 예는 EIP-4844가 컨센서스 레이어의 향후 변경 사항과 호환될 수 있어 L2 개발자가 업그레이드할 필요가 없다는 것입니다.
또한 EVM 애플리케이션, 블록 데이터, 증인 데이터 및 상태 크기와 같은 다양한 유형의 리소스에 대한 사용량과 수수료를 분리하는 이더리움 L1에 대한 다차원 수수료 시장을 도입합니다. 그리고 이러한 모든 리소스에는 서로 다른 용량 제한이 있습니다. 즉, 각 리소스에 서로 다른 가격 책정 메커니즘이 있는 경우 효율적인 방식으로 할당됩니다. 그러나 이더리움 L1은 현재 이 모든 자원을 사용하는 비용, 즉 Gas fee를 측정하기 위해 단일 메트릭을 사용하고 있어 매우 비효율적입니다.
Proto-danksharding은 다차원 EIP-1559 수수료 시장을 소개합니다. 여기에는 독립적인 유동 가스 가격 및 한도가 있는 두 가지 리소스, 가스 수수료 및 blob이 있습니다.
즉, 두 개의 변수와 네 개의 상수가 있습니다.
EIP-4844의 단점은 무엇입니까?
출처: https://www.eip4844.com
EIP-4844의 다음 단계는 무엇입니까?
EIP-4844의 주요 구조는 명확해졌지만 여전히 연구 중인 측면이 있습니다. 이더리움 코어 팀이 현재 3분기 언젠가 일어날 것으로 예상되는 다가오는 합병에 몰두하고 있다는 것은 말할 필요도 없습니다. 핵심 개발자들은 EIP-4844가 합병 후 약 6개월, 즉 2023년 1~2분기에 구현될 것으로 예상한다고 언급했습니다.
Danksharding + EIP-4844 모두 Ethereum L1의 향후 로드맵이 데이터 가용성 + 보안 계층의 롤업이 되는 것임을 분명히 합니다. Danksharding은 향후 18-24개월 내에 구현될 것으로 예상되는 반면 EIP-4844 자체는 6-9개월 내에 구현될 것입니다.
작성자: Gokhan Er, IOSG Ventures